Commercial property clearing services involve the removal of unwanted structures, debris, and materials from business sites, vacant lots, or industrial spaces. These services typically include the demolition of existing buildings, clearing land of old fixtures, and hauling away waste materials to prepare a property for new development or use. The goal is to create a clean, safe, and accessible space that meets the specific needs of commercial clients, whether they are planning to build new facilities or simply need to clear the area for other purposes.

This type of service helps resolve common property issues such as cluttered or unsafe sites, overgrown lots, or remnants of previous structures that hinder development plans. It can also address zoning or safety concerns by removing hazardous materials or unstable structures. Clearing services are an essential step for businesses looking to expand, renovate, or repurpose their properties, ensuring the site is ready for the next phase of development without delays caused by debris or unwanted features.

Typical properties that utilize commercial clearing services include office complexes, retail centers, warehouses, industrial parks, and vacant land parcels. These spaces often require extensive work to remove old buildings, concrete slabs, fencing, or landscaping before new construction can begin. Property owners or developers may also need clearing services after natural events or accidents that leave debris or damaged structures on the site. In any case, professional clearing helps streamline the process of preparing a property for its intended use.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Property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fort Walton Beach,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small-Scale Clearing - typical costs range from $250-$600 for routine jobs like removing debris or small shrubs. Most projects fall within this range, especially for straightforward tasks on smaller properties.

Medium Projects - clearing larger areas or removing multiple structures can cost between $600-$2,000. These jobs are common for property upgrades or preparation work on commercial sites.

Extensive Clearing - larger, more complex projects such as tree removal or site preparation often range from $2,000-$5,000. Fewer projects reach these higher costs, usually involving extensive equipment or labor.

Full Property Reclamation - complete clearing of large commercial sites can exceed $5,000, depending on size and complexity. These are less frequent but necessary for major redevelopment or site restoration efforts.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
